Adani Green Energy moves up on bagging tenders for setting up solar generation projects

13 Jul 2018 Evaluate

Adani Green Energy is currently trading at Rs. 31.45, up by 0.30 points or 0.96% from its previous closing of Rs. 31.15 on the BSE.

The scrip opened at Rs. 32.45 and has touched a high and low of Rs. 32.55 and Rs. 31.20 respectively. So far 45787 shares were traded on the counter.

The BSE group 'B' stock of face value Rs. 10 has touched a 52 week high of Rs. 33.45 on 11-Jul-2018 and a 52 week low of Rs. 22.75 on 02-Jul-2018.

Last one week high and low of the scrip stood at Rs. 33.45 and Rs. 30.00 respectively. The current market cap of the company is Rs. 4911.00 crore.

The promoters holding in the company stood at 86.58%, while Institutions and Non-Institutions held 11.18% and 2.24% respectively.

Adani Green Energy (AGEL) through its wholly owned subsidiary, Mahoba Solar (UP), has won tenders for setting up 300 MWac solar generation projects. In the tender floated by Uttar Pradesh New and Renewable Energy Development Agency (UPNEDA), it won 250 MWac solar generation projects to be set up in the State of Uttar Pradesh and supply power to Uttar Pradesh Power Corporation. The fixed PPA tariff is Rs 3.48/kWh for a period of 25 years. The Project is expected to be commissioned by Q3 FY 2020.

Separately, it has won a tender for 50 MWac solar generation project to be set up anywhere in India and connected through Inter State Transmission System (ISTS). The tender was floated by Solar Energy Corporation of India (SECI) and which shall also be the PPA counterparty. The fixed PPA tariff is Rs 2.54/kWh for a period of 25 years. Project is expected to be commissioned by Q2 FY 2021.
